Basic Usage:
The main user interface to MacPorts is the port command and the various facilities it provides for installing ports.
The first thing you should do after you install MacPorts is to make sure it is fully up to date by pulling the latest revisions to the Portfiles and any updated MacPorts base code from our rsync server, all accomplished simply by running the port selfupdate command as the Unix superuser:
sudo port selfupdate
Running this command on a regular basis is a good idea, it ensures your MacPorts installation is always up to date. Afterwards, you may search for ports to install:
port search
where is the name of the port you are searching for, or a partial name. To install a port youve chosen, you need to run the port install command as the Unix superuser:
sudo port install
where now maps to an exact port name in the ports tree, such as those returned by the command port search. Please consult the port(1) man page for complete documentation for this command and the software installation process.

Pantomime 1.2pre2
Pantomime provides a set of Objective-C classes that model a mail system more>>
Pantomime is almost entirely written in Objective-C. The C language is only used where performance is critical. Pantomime uses a little bit of ELM code.
Main features:
- A full MIME encoder and decoder
- A folder view to local mailboxes (Berkeley Format), POP3 accounts or IMAP mailboxes
- A powerful API to work on all aspects of Message objects
- A local mailer and a SMTP conduit for sending messages
- APOP and SMTP AUTH support
- IMAP and POP3 URL Scheme support
- iconv and Core Foundation support
- maildir support
- SSL support for IMAP, POP3 and SMTP.

PortFinder 0.6
PortFinder - Look up port numbers & application name mappings more>>
You can search by port number or name, list all port mappings or list all unassigned ports.
Searching by port number will search for the database for the exact port number.
Searching by name will search the database for any entry containing the search string. The name search is not limited to the name field in the database so it can be used to search for ports containing the search string if it is a number.
